
关于这些评测阶段,应制定规范,对其评测类型、评测技能要求等清晰要求。这方面,在军方、航空航天等范畴有许多规范就可供参阅。实践实施时,规范应依据不同软件类型的重要性、安全性要害等级供给取舍。文档评测的要评测目标是软件需求规格阐明书和软件规划文档。安顺大数据项目评审文档一般运用文字进行阐明,因而不行防止地具有而二义性和不清晰性。软件评测中的文档评测要是对相关的规划陈述和用户运用阐明等文档进行评测,优良大数据项目评审一般应符合以下的技能要求:关于规划陈述要是评测程序与规划陈述中的规划思想是否共同;关于用户运用阐明进行评测时,要是评测用户运用阐明书中对程序操作方法的描绘是否正确,用户运用阐明中提到的操作比如要进行评测,确保选用的比如可以在程序中正确完结操作。

静态查验:指不作业被测程序自身,优良大数据项目评审经过剖析或查看源程序的语法、结构、进程、接口等来查看程序的正确性。动态查验:是指经过作业被测程序,查看作业与预期的差异,大数据项目评审咨询并剖析作业功率、正确性和健壮性等功用方针。单元查验:又称模块查验,是针对软件规划的小单位----程序模块或功用模块,进行正确性查验的查验作业。其意图在于查验程序各模块是否存在过错,是否能正确地完结了其功用,满意其功用和接口要求。集成查验:又名拼装查验或联合,是单元查验的多级扩展,是在单元查验的根底上进行的一种有序查验。旨在查验软件单元之间的接口联络,以期望经过查验发现各软件单元接口之间存在的问题,把经过查验的单元组成符合规划要求的软件。

大数据功用调优1.在大数据范畴普遍存在数据歪斜的问题,优良大数据项目评审需求参阅对应组件的文档2.参阅业界的事例介绍,大数据相关的测验,基准测验 单一用户单个事务的测验,意图是在对挑选的用户在无压力的状况下获取体系处理单个恳求的状况,负载测验 经过逐步添加体系的负载,测验体系功用的改变,稳定性测验 经过给体系加载的事务压力,运转7*24 小时,以此检测体系是否稳定运转。大数据项目评审咨询功用测验 是在OLAP引擎挑选的时分,需求测验其对标准SQL支撑的状况,如部分不支撑update和delete操作, 不支撑with句子,不支撑except和intersection操作等功用需求 CPU,内存,磁盘IO,网络负载运用率不过80% 呼应时刻 90%的 读取 写入 导出 导入不过3s,有不到10%的呼应时刻不过 5s

评测需求是整个评测进程的根底;承认评测目标以及评测作业的规模和作用。用来承认整个评测作业(如安排时刻表、评测规划等)并作为评测掩盖的根底。并且被承认的评测需求项要是可核实的。它们要有一个可观察、可评测的成果。无法核实的需求不是评测需求。所以我现在的了解是评测需求是一个比较大的概念,优良大数据项目评审它是在整个评测计划文档中体现出来的,不是类似的一个用例或许其他. 大数据项目评审咨询评测需求是制订评测计划的根本依据,承认了评测需求可以为评测计划供给客观依据;评测需求是规划评测用例的辅导,承认了要测什么、测哪些方面后才能有针对性的规划评测用例;评测需求是核算评测掩盖的分母,没有评测需求就无法有用地进行评测掩盖。

进程一:数据阶段验证,大数据测验的一步,也称作pre-hadoop阶段该进程包含如下验证:1)来自各方面的数据资源应该被验证,来保障正确的大数据项目评审咨询数据被加载进体系。2)将源数据与推送到Hadoop体系中的数据进行比较,以保障它们匹配。3)验证正确的数据被提取并被加载到HDFS正确的位置。该阶段可以运用东西Talend或Datameer,进行数据阶段验证。进程二:"MapReduce"验证,大数据测验的第二步是MapReduce的验证。在这个阶段,优良大数据项目评审测验者在每个节点上进职事务逻辑验证,然后在运转多个节点后验证它们,保障如下操作的正确性:1)Map与Reduce进程正常作业。2)在数据上施行数据聚合或隔规矩。3)生成键值对。4)在履行Map和Reduce进程后验证数据。